
Justin Gaethje to Sit Out 2026 Due to Injuries
Justin Gaethje has stated that he will not participate in any fights in 2026 as he focuses on recovering from hand injuries incurred during two bouts earlier this year. These fights included a victory over Paddy Pimblett in January and a stoppage win against Ilia Topuria in June.
Gaethje mentioned that he is unable to punch due to the ongoing pain in both hands and plans to enjoy his championship status for the remainder of the year. He indicated that he will consult with family and evaluate his options before making any decisions about his future in the sport.
While Gaethje has expressed a desire to fight again, he is not currently considering an immediate rematch with Topuria, noting that Topuria also has recovery needs following their fight. He acknowledged that the UFC will ultimately decide his next opponent, and given the circumstances, he does not anticipate fighting Topuria next.
